Amid trails, lakes, and lush greenery in the Serra da Cantareira, there is a rustic village that has become a must-visit stop for those seeking a unique getaway.
O Velhão, in Mairiporã, features a wood-fired restaurant, antiques, cafes, small shops, and buildings that look like they’re straight out of a movie. All of this right in the northern part of São Paulo.
O Velhão: where cuisine, nature, and nostalgia meet
Founded in the 1970s by Moacyr Archanjo dos Santos and his wife Iracema, the space began as a store selling salvaged items and antiques.
Over the years, it grew to become one of the most traditional attractions in the Serra da Cantareira. After all, it combines cuisine, art, nature, and a nostalgic atmosphere that is hard to find so close to the capital.
The As Véia restaurant remains the heart of the complex, with Dona Iracema still at the helm of the kitchen. Known for its Brazilian dishes cooked over a wood-fired stove, it still features interiors filled with wood, antique objects, and rustic decor.
On weekends, the venue also hosts the famous colonial-style breakfast, featuring homemade cakes, breads, pastries, and traditional treats amidst the mountain atmosphere.

Much more than just a restaurant
In addition, the cafes scattered throughout the venue still make us feel like we’re in a real antique shop, with collector’s items and offerings for coffee lovers.
The experience, however, goes far beyond the food. Strolling through O Velhão is part of the outing: among cobblestone streets, antique furniture, gardens, and buildings inspired by Italian villages, every corner seems designed for those who love discovering places full of character.
Those who decide to extend their visit into the evening will also find a pizzeria, a brewery, and live music performances featuring rock and pop-rock bands. The complex also features craft and home decor shops with handmade pieces and rustic-style items.
